Subject: [PATCH AUTOSEL 4.14 01/20] ASoC: dwc: limit the number of overrun messages

From: Maxim Kochetkov <fido_max@...ox.ru>

[ Upstream commit ab6ecfbf40fccf74b6ec2ba7ed6dd2fc024c3af2 ]

On slow CPU (FPGA/QEMU emulated) printing overrun messages from
interrupt handler to uart console may leads to more overrun errors.
So use dev_err_ratelimited to limit the number of error messages.

 sound/soc/dwc/dwc-i2s.c |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/sound/soc/dwc/dwc-i2s.c b/sound/soc/dwc/dwc-i2s.c
index e27e21f8569a0..e6a0ec3c0e764 100644
--- a/sound/soc/dwc/dwc-i2s.c
+++ b/sound/soc/dwc/dwc-i2s.c
@@ -132,13 +132,13 @@ static irqreturn_t i2s_irq_handler(int irq, void *dev_id)
 
 		/* Error Handling: TX */
 		if (isr[i] & ISR_TXFO) {
-			dev_err(dev->dev, "TX overrun (ch_id=%d)\n", i);
+			dev_err_ratelimited(dev->dev, "TX overrun (ch_id=%d)\n", i);
 			irq_valid = true;
 		}
 
 		/* Error Handling: TX */
 		if (isr[i] & ISR_RXFO) {
-			dev_err(dev->dev, "RX overrun (ch_id=%d)\n", i);
+			dev_err_ratelimited(dev->dev, "RX overrun (ch_id=%d)\n", i);
 			irq_valid = true;
 		}
 	}
